Abstract
Embodiments of the present disclosure provide a method and apparatus for processing image data, the method including: generating a first window and a second window; loading preview image data in the first window; acquiring at least one of a feature image, current time information and geographical location information; loading at least one of the feature image, the time information and the geographical location information in the second window; and when receiving a generation instruction of the image data, embedding the at least one of the feature image, the time information and the geographical location information into generated target image data according to a first coordinate position, the first coordinate position being a coordinate of the at least one of the feature image, the time information and the geographical location information in the second window relative to the preview image data. The embodiments of the present disclosure achieve automation of post processing of the image data, greatly increase simplicity of operation, lower the operation threshold, and reduce the processing time.
